The Israeli military announced Tuesday that it had struck Hezbollah infrastructure in southern Lebanon, targeting a training complex for the elite al-Radwan force, launch sites, firing ranges, weapons training areas, and military structures.Finance Minister Bezalel Smotrich indicated Israel would "likely" need to intensify operations against the organization, stating, "We will not allow Hezbollah to remain."The IDF asserted these actions violated understandings between Israel and Lebanon and threatened Israel's security, with at least one attacked site near a school in Jbaa sustaining "heavy" damage.These actions occur despite a November 2024 ceasefire agreement, and follow Hezbollah's significant weakening after the September 2024 assassination of its leader, Hassan Nasrallah.
